Output d594fb35bc3bbda4e25fb59fc3a758399501b757632a6de1be9ddf59c33aafbb:0

value
2341273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21053331103ff0e5e1e6beb349e6ba0b51f2deb5 OP_EQUAL
address
34hcTB4MMPcbxYhUDELVyr1WPSyLAKdG3j
transaction
d594fb35bc3bbda4e25fb59fc3a758399501b757632a6de1be9ddf59c33aafbb
spent
true